Abstract

The protein von Willebrand factor (VWF) is essential in primary hemostasis, as it mediates platelet adhesion to vessel walls. VWF retains its compact (globule-like) shape in equilibrium due to internal molecular associations, but is able to stretch when a high enough shear stress is applied. Even though the shear-flow sensitivity of VWF conformation is well accepted, the behavior of VWF under realistic blood flow conditions remains poorly understood. We perform mesoscopic numerical simulations together with microfluidic experiments in order to characterize VWF behavior in blood flow for a wide range of flow-rate and hematocrit conditions. In particular, our results demonstrate that the compact shape of VWF is important for its migration (or margination) toward vessel walls and that VWF stretches primarily in a near-wall region in blood flow making its adhesion possible. Our results show that VWF is a highly optimized protein in terms of its size and internal associations which are necessary to achieve its vital function. A better understanding of the relevant mechanisms for VWF behavior in microcirculation provides a further step toward the elucidation of the role of mutations in various VWF-related diseases.

摘要

在原发性止血中,蛋白质 von Willebrand 因子(VWF)是必不可少的,因为它介导血小板与血管壁的黏附。VWF 由于内部分子相互作用而在平衡时保持其紧凑(球样)形状,但在施加足够高的剪切力时能够伸展。尽管 VWF 构象的剪切流敏感性已被广泛接受,但在实际血流条件下 VWF 的行为仍知之甚少。我们进行介观数值模拟和微流控实验,以表征在广泛的流速和血细胞比容条件下血液流动中 VWF 的行为。特别是,我们的结果表明,VWF 的紧凑形状对于其向血管壁的迁移(或边缘堆积)很重要,并且 VWF 主要在血流中的近壁区域伸展,从而使其能够黏附。我们的结果表明,VWF 是一种在大小和内部相互作用方面高度优化的蛋白质,这是实现其重要功能所必需的。更好地理解 VWF 在微循环中的相关机制,为阐明各种与 VWF 相关疾病中突变的作用提供了进一步的研究方向。
